Michał Szczęsny
ATTORNEY-AT-LAW
He specialises in public procurement law and the implementation of projects financed from EU funds. He has been involved in public procurement from the beginning of his professional career.
He provided legal assistance to contractors and ordering parties in the implementation of large infrastructure contracts, including the construction of national and express roads. He has extensive experience in controlling public procurement procedures financed from EU funds.
On a daily basis, he supports public procurers (including sectoral ones) and contractors. He represents the beneficiaries of EU funds in proceedings regarding financial corrections and reimbursement of EU funds. He successfully represents clients before the National Chamber of Public Procurement and the Court of Public Procurement.
He conducts trainings in the area of public procurement. Author of numerous legal publications in the field of public procurement law.
Graduate of the Faculty of Law and Administration at the University of Silesia. He completed his attorney-at-law traineeship; entered into the list of attorneys-at-law at the Katowice Bar Association of Attorneys-at-Law.
